excel里面文字怎么转换成word

excel里面文字怎么转换成word

在Excel中将文字转换成Word的几种方法包括:复制粘贴、邮件合并、VBA宏、数据导出为文本文件。本文将详细介绍这些方法,并提供相关技巧和注意事项,帮助你在不同场景下选择最适合的方案。

一、复制粘贴

这种方法是最简单、直接的方式,适用于小规模的数据处理。

1. 选择并复制Excel中的文字

首先,打开你的Excel文件,选择你想要转换成Word的文字内容。你可以通过拖动鼠标选择单元格,或者使用快捷键Ctrl+C进行复制。

2. 打开Word并粘贴

打开一个新的或现有的Word文档,选择你希望粘贴内容的位置,使用快捷键Ctrl+V进行粘贴。Excel中的表格格式会保持不变,但你可以根据需要在Word中进行进一步调整。

3. 格式调整

如果需要,你可以在Word中进一步调整字体、段落和表格格式,以满足你的特定需求。例如,你可以使用Word的表格工具来调整列宽、合并单元格或添加边框。

二、邮件合并

邮件合并是一个强大的工具,尤其适用于需要将Excel数据批量转换为多个Word文档的场景。

1. 准备Excel数据

确保你的Excel数据表格是结构化的,每一行代表一个记录,每一列代表一个字段。例如,你可能有一列是姓名,另一列是地址。

2. 在Word中启动邮件合并

打开Word,选择“邮件”选项卡,然后点击“开始邮件合并”,选择“信函”。接下来,点击“选择收件人”,选择“使用现有列表”,然后找到并选择你的Excel文件。

3. 插入合并字段

在Word文档中,点击“插入合并字段”,选择你希望插入的Excel字段。你可以根据需要在Word文档中插入多个字段来创建个性化的文档内容。

4. 预览结果并完成合并

点击“预览结果”查看合并后的文档内容,确保一切正常。最后,点击“完成并合并”,选择“编辑单个文档”或“打印文档”来生成最终的Word文件。

三、VBA宏

VBA宏是一个更高级的方法,适用于需要自动化处理大量数据的用户。

1. 打开Excel并启用开发者选项

首先,打开你的Excel文件,确保开发者选项已启用。如果没有启用,可以通过“文件” > “选项” > “自定义功能区”,勾选“开发者”选项。

2. 编写VBA宏

点击“开发者”选项卡,选择“Visual Basic”打开VBA编辑器。在VBA编辑器中,插入一个新模块,并编写以下代码:

Sub ExportToWord()

Dim wdApp As Object

Dim wdDoc As Object

Dim ws As Worksheet

Dim rng As Range

Set ws = ThisWorkbook.Sheets("Sheet1") ' 替换为你的工作表名称

Set rng = ws.Range("A1:B10") ' 替换为你要导出的单元格范围

Set wdApp = CreateObject("Word.Application")

Set wdDoc = wdApp.Documents.Add

wdApp.Visible = True

For Each cell In rng

wdDoc.Content.InsertAfter cell.Value & vbTab

If cell.Column = rng.Columns.Count Then

wdDoc.Content.InsertAfter vbCrLf

End If

Next cell

wdDoc.SaveAs2 "C:YourPathExportedDocument.docx" ' 替换为你的文件路径

wdDoc.Close

wdApp.Quit

Set wdDoc = Nothing

Set wdApp = Nothing

End Sub

3. 运行宏

回到Excel,点击“开发者”选项卡,选择“宏”,找到你刚刚创建的宏并运行。VBA宏将自动打开Word,创建一个新文档,并将Excel中的数据导入到Word中。

四、数据导出为文本文件

这种方法适用于需要将Excel数据转换为纯文本格式再导入Word的场景。

1. 将Excel数据保存为文本文件

首先,打开你的Excel文件,选择你想要转换的数据区域。点击“文件” > “另存为”,选择保存类型为“文本文件(制表符分隔)(*.txt)”,然后保存文件。

2. 打开Word并导入文本文件

打开Word,选择“文件” > “打开”,找到并选择你刚刚保存的文本文件。Word会自动将文本文件导入并显示在文档中。

3. 格式调整

根据需要,你可以在Word中进一步调整文本格式。例如,你可以使用“查找和替换”功能来替换制表符或段落标记,或者使用段落格式工具来调整行距和对齐方式。

五、总结

在Excel中将文字转换成Word的几种方法各有优缺点,适用于不同的场景。复制粘贴适用于小规模数据,邮件合并适用于批量处理,VBA宏适用于自动化处理,数据导出为文本文件适用于纯文本格式转换。选择适合你需求的方法,可以大大提高工作效率,减少手动操作的时间和错误率。

相关问答FAQs:

1. 如何将Excel中的文字内容转换为Word文档?

您可以按照以下步骤将Excel中的文字内容转换为Word文档:

  • 打开Excel文件,并选择需要转换的文字内容。
  • 复制所选文字内容,可以使用快捷键Ctrl+C。
  • 打开Word文档,将光标移动到您希望粘贴文字的位置。
  • 粘贴文字内容,可以使用快捷键Ctrl+V。
  • 根据需要进行格式调整和编辑,以确保转换后的文字在Word文档中呈现出理想的样式。

2. 我如何将Excel表格中的文字转换为Word文档中的段落?

如果您希望将Excel表格中的文字按照段落的形式转换为Word文档,可以按照以下步骤操作:

  • 打开Excel文件,并选择需要转换的文字内容。
  • 复制所选文字内容,可以使用快捷键Ctrl+C。
  • 打开Word文档,将光标移动到您希望粘贴文字的位置。
  • 粘贴文字内容,可以使用快捷键Ctrl+V。
  • 在Word文档中对转换后的文字进行格式调整,例如添加段落间距、调整字体样式等,以确保文字呈现出清晰的段落结构。

3. 如何将Excel单元格中的文字转换为Word文档中的标题?

如果您希望将Excel单元格中的文字转换为Word文档中的标题,可以按照以下步骤进行操作:

  • 打开Excel文件,并选择需要转换的文字内容。
  • 复制所选文字内容,可以使用快捷键Ctrl+C。
  • 打开Word文档,将光标移动到您希望插入标题的位置。
  • 在Word文档中选择适当的标题级别,例如一级标题、二级标题等。
  • 粘贴文字内容,可以使用快捷键Ctrl+V。
  • 在Word文档中对转换后的标题进行格式调整,例如更改字体样式、调整字号等,以确保标题在文档中具有醒目的效果。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4746464

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部